Historically, cinema treated stepparents as villains or punchlines. The "wicked stepmother" of Disney lore or the "clueless stepdad" of early comedies created a cultural shorthand that framed blended families as inherently troubled or abnormal .

Blended family dynamics in modern cinema have moved toward a more inclusive, messy, and ultimately hopeful representation of human connection. By moving away from "evil" archetypes and toward the messiness of parenting, cinema now reflects a world where family isn't just something you're born into—it’s something you actively build.

The definition of "blended" has expanded to include found families —groups forged by choice rather than blood. Films like Moonlight (2016) and Shoplifters (2018) showcase how individuals from marginalized backgrounds create deep familial bonds outside traditional legal or biological structures.
